Three West Brom transfers to be completed this weekend

The Baggies completed their first summer signing on Thursday as midfielder Ousmane Diakite joined on a free transfer. The Malian, who played 34 times last season and scored two goals for Austrian Bundesliga side TSV Hartberg, has signed a two-year contract with the club option for a further 12 months.

Baggies transfer awaiting announcement
West Brom are expected to follow up the acquisition of Diakite with the signing of IF Brommapojkarna star Tobjorn Heggem. The defender, who will sign on a permanent deal, has passed a medical following an agreement on a fee.

Predominantly a centre-half but regularly utilised at left-back, the Norwegian is set to offer Carlos Corberan terrific versatilty at the back. It’s a clever move as Heggem can directly replace the outgoing Erik Pieters. His height will also be useful if Cedric Kipre departs.
